GitHub - https://github.com/azahalski/awz.dealsproductfield/
Маркетплейс 1с-Битрикс:
https://marketplace.1c-bitrix.ru/solutions/awz.dealsproductfield/
Краткое описание
Модуль awz.dealsproductfield добавляет новый тип пользовательского поля для Bitrix CRM, позволяющий выбирать сделки и конкретные товары из товарного набора этих сделок.
Подробное описание
Модуль расширяет функциональность пользовательских полей Bitrix, добавляя тип поля awz_deals_product. Это поле предназначено для работы в CRM-системе и позволяет:
- Выбирать сделки из CRM с использованием стандартного селектора сущностей (EntitySelector)
- Выбирать товары из товарного набора каждой выбранной сделки
- Просматривать детали сделки и список её товаров с ценами и количеством
- Работать с множественными полями — можно добавить несколько разных сделок с выбранными товарами
Основные возможности
- Интерфейс выбора: Использует стандартный UI EntitySelector Bitrix для удобного выбора сделок
- Автоматическое определение контекста: При редактировании поля в карточке сделки, эта сделка автоматически добавляется в список выбранных
- Хранение данных: Данные хранятся в формате JSON с информацией о сделках и выбранных товарах
- API контроллер: Предоставляет методы для получения списка товаров сделки, информации о сделке и поиска сделок
- Права доступа: Проверяет права чтения сделок перед отображением данных

























